Why do stars twinkle in the night sky?

Stars twinkle in the night sky because of the Earth's atmosphere. As starlight passes through the atmosphere, it gets refracted due to the changes in density. This causes the light to scatter in different directions, creating the twinkling effect.

How far away are the stars that we see in the night sky?

The stars we see in the night sky are located at various distances from the Earth. The nearest star to us is the Sun, which is approximately 93 million miles away. The distance to other stars is measured in light-years, which is the distance light travels in one year. The closest star to the Earth, apart from the Sun, is Proxima Centauri, located about 4.2 light-years away.

Can we ever reach the stars and explore other star systems?

While it is currently not possible to physically reach the stars due to their immense distances, there are ongoing efforts and research to explore other star systems. Scientists are working on developing advanced spacecraft, such as the proposed Breakthrough Starshot, which aims to send tiny robotic spacecraft to our nearest star system, Alpha Centauri, within a few decades. However, manned interstellar travel is still a distant dream.

How do stars form in the night sky?

Stars form in the night sky through the process of stellar evolution. They are born from the gravitational collapse of massive clouds of gas and dust called nebulae. As these clouds contract, the material at the core becomes denser and hotter, eventually triggering nuclear fusion. When fusion begins, a star is born and it starts emitting light and heat. The entire process can take millions of years.

Why do different stars have different colors?

Stars have different colors due to differences in their surface temperatures. The color of a star is directly related to its temperature. Hotter stars appear bluish-white, while cooler stars appear more reddish. This is because the surface temperature affects the wavelength of the light the star emits. Stars with intermediate temperatures, like our Sun, appear yellow. The color of a star is a useful indicator of its temperature and stage of evolution.
